Delivery Coordinator | Calgary, AB | 12 déc. 2020
Long shifts. Work on weekends hard family balance.
Great staff and good people working there. Just long shifts. Deliver refrigerators up stairs and heavy furniture if your into it. If customers have not moved their old couch you Have to move it for them.

Assistant | Ottawa, ON | 27 févr. 2013
Did not value employees
Low hourly wage, regularly worked 8AM until 6 or 8PM while technically a part-time employee. Expected to use my personal vehicle for company purposes, and never received reimbursement for mileage, which i was told would happen. extreme micro-managing was a part of everyday life

Office Supervisor | Red Deer, AB | 22 août 2017
easy and fun job.
Leons is a good job for someone entry level into front office, customer service or warehouse work. As front office my daily work was phones, reports, filing, paper work, booking deliveries, calling customers, taking calls, cleaning, taking payments and handling financing as well as cash.

Door Supervisor | Edmonton, AB | 27 juin 2015
Entry level workplace with little chance of advancement
Entry level workplace, rapid change of workers.
Managers and coworkers are friendly, but without proper human resource regulations, it is hard to work here for a long time.
Inventory, receiving and management skills can be learnt here, which is the best part.
When there is little customers--and it happens frequently-- the job can be super boring.
There is little chance to get a raise unless changing the position.
A very good place for young people to gain experience, but it is not a place for career seekers.
